Year-over-year, Pope County’s typical home value in June 2026 slipped slightly, down about 4 percent, while the statewide median rose a bit over 2 percent. Listing activity also cooled from last year, with active listings falling nearly 17 percent and new listings down almost 16 percent, even as Arkansas overall saw inventory edge higher.

Looking at the latest month, prices and inventory show some short-term shifts. The typical home value climbed about 5 percent from May, yet the median list price dropped more than 15 percent, and active listings dipped around 4 percent, suggesting sellers may be adjusting expectations to keep buyers engaged.

Conditions on the ground point to a seller-leaning market, with just 2.6 months of supply in Pope County compared with 4.7 months across Arkansas. At the same time, homes are taking longer to sell than a year ago, with the median days on market now at 43 and only about 5 percent of sales closing above list, while the average sale-to-list ratio sits just under 97 percent. Pope County offers residents a welcoming community, abundant outdoor recreation, strong schools, and a practical, family‑friendly quality of life.

Pope County combines small city convenience with quick access to outdoor recreation, anchored by Russellville along the Arkansas River and framed by the Ozark foothills. Major routes like I‑40 and Highway 7 make commuting to Conway or Fort Smith straightforward while keeping daily life manageable and affordable.

Residents enjoy practical amenities close at hand. The City of Russellville offers a full calendar of community events, while Arkansas Tech University adds educational, cultural, and athletic opportunities that appeal to students and long‑time locals alike. Families appreciate access to the Russellville School District and the area’s neighborhood parks, including Bona Dea Trails & Sanctuary, known for its paved paths and wildlife viewing.

Outdoor enthusiasts can quickly reach Lake Dardanelle State Park for boating, fishing, and camping, or head north toward hiking in the Ozark-St. Francis National Forest. Day‑to‑day needs are served by local shops, healthcare providers, and a steadily growing dining scene in downtown Russellville and nearby Clarksville.
